West Virginia
Division of Health and Human Resources Office
Services include: WV Children's Health Insurance Program (CHIP); Women Infants and Childrens Program (WIC); WV Immunization Program; WV Division of Tobacco Prevention; WV Family Planning Program, food stamps, cash assistance, Medicaid, WV Works and more. Visit www.wvdhhr.org for a full list of programs and services.

Ohio
Department of Jobs and Family Services
Services include career counseling, education and training, unemployment, Medicaid, food stamps, financial assistance, multiple health services. For a full listing, visit http://jfs.ohio.gov/
